Research Interests

Dr. Howard, as a Solid State Physicist, is primarily interested in crystals and crystal structure. Background in mineralogy and inorganic chemistry allows him to work with both natural and laboratory prepared compounds. The work makes use of x-ray diffraction, x-ray fluorescence and scanning electron microscopy. Recent work includes:

Identifying and characterizing new naturally-occurring minerals.

Growing and characterizing new inorganic phases of double salts.

In addition, he has developed a computer-based spectrometer for Mossbauer spectroscopy utilizing Fe57 as a probe to study the properties of solids and surfaces. Applications include:

Identification of iron-containing minerals in rock samples, in particular, estimating the relative concentrations of ferrous and ferric iron to study the degree of oxidation of the rock.

Relating the direction and magnitude of internal magnetic fields and quadrupole electric field gradients to the crystallographic structure of minerals and chemical compounds.

Studying the adsorption of molecules from gases and aqueous solutions onto graphite surfaces.
